Texas Hold'em Strategy Fundamentals

Texas Hold'em remains the most widely played poker variant worldwide, demanding a sophisticated understanding of position, pot odds, and hand selection. Success in Hold'em relies on recognizing that your position at the table fundamentally influences which starting hands warrant playing. Early position requires significantly tighter hand selection, while late position allows for expanded opening ranges due to informational advantage.

The mathematical foundation of Hold'em strategy centers on pot odds calculation. When facing a bet, you must compare the odds of completing your hand against the compensation offered by the current pot size. This objective analysis separates profitable decisions from emotional gambling. Professional players consistently calculate whether drawing to a flush or straight provides adequate mathematical expectation before committing additional chips.

Positional play extends beyond hand selection into bet sizing and aggression patterns. Players in late position can control pot size, extract value with marginal hands, and apply pressure to opponents with fold equity. Conversely, early position requires restraint and premium hands, as multiple opponents remain to act behind you, increasing the likelihood of superior holdings in the field.

Omaha Poker: Strategy for Four-Card Complexity

Omaha presents distinct strategic challenges compared to Hold'em, primarily because each player receives four hole cards instead of two. This fundamental difference dramatically alters hand strength evaluation, drawing probabilities, and optimal betting patterns. Omaha players must use exactly two cards from their hand combined with three community cards to form their best five-card poker hand—a constraint that significantly influences hand selection philosophy.

Hand selection in Omaha emphasizes coordinated cards that work together synergistically. Unlike Hold'em where any two cards can potentially win, Omaha requires premium holdings with connected, suited combinations offering multiple drawing paths. Starting hands like AAKK double-suited or AAJT with two suits provide superior equity against random holdings, while disconnected hands like 2378 unsuited possess minimal strategic value regardless of chip position.

The mathematical landscape shifts considerably in Omaha due to increased drawing frequencies. Straight and flush completions occur with substantially higher probability when players draw to two cards simultaneously. Consequently, made hands require significantly greater defensive strategy, and passive play often results in unfavorable outcomes as opponents improve on later streets with superior probability calculations.


Stud Games: Strategy for Card-Exposed Variants

Seven-Card Stud and Five-Card Stud represent classical poker variants where partial hand information becomes visible to all players. This structural difference from Hold'em and Omaha creates unique strategic opportunities centered on card reading, opponent hand analysis, and incomplete information management. In Stud variants, professional players develop exceptional skill at calculating probable opponent holdings based on exposed cards and betting patterns.

Strategic advantages in Stud games derive substantially from understanding positional factors and active opponent counts. Playing strong opening hands becomes increasingly valuable when fewer players remain active, while marginal holdings demand significantly higher equity requirements when facing multiple aggressive opponents. Additionally, Stud players must continuously update hand strength assessments as additional cards become exposed, incorporating new information into their probability calculations.

The branching complexity of Stud variants demands advanced analytical skills. Players track folded cards, calculate outs, and estimate opponent ranges using only partial information. Successful Stud players combine mathematical precision with intuitive hand reading ability, recognizing that statistical analysis alone cannot account for the psychological and behavioral dimensions of opponent play.

Advanced Strategic Concepts

Bankroll Management

Proper bankroll allocation prevents catastrophic losses. Maintain sufficient capital reserves to navigate natural variance without emotional decision-making. Professional players typically maintain 20-40 buy-ins for their target stakes.

Tournament Strategy

Tournament poker demands dynamic strategy adjustment based on stack sizes, blind structures, and field composition. Early-stage play emphasizes value and hand strength, while late-stage strategy incorporates increased aggression and fold equity exploitation.

Position and Range Construction

Advanced players develop position-specific hand ranges incorporating game flow dynamics. Range construction considers opponent tendencies, stack depths, and action sequences to optimize expected value across all decision points.

Mathematical Foundation

The Probability and Statistics Behind Poker Decisions

Expected Value Calculations

All profitable poker decisions derive from positive expected value analysis. Calculate the product of probability success multiplied by win amount minus probability failure multiplied by loss amount. Only decisions producing positive expected value merit execution regardless of immediate outcomes.

Variance and Standard Deviation

Understanding variance protects against misinterpreting statistical noise as skill deficiency. Professional poker players expect significant short-term fluctuations even when making mathematically optimal decisions. Proper variance understanding prevents tilt and maintains emotional equilibrium during inevitable downswings.
